当前位置:首页 > 行业动态 > 正文

如何在Dede模板页中实现Arclist分页效果?

要在dede模板页中实现arclist分页效果,可以使用以下代码:,,“ html,{dede:arclist typeid='1' row='10' titlelen='30' infolen='120' orderby='hot'},[field:title/],{/dede:arclist},“,,这段代码会显示类型ID为1的文章列表,每页显示10篇文章,标题长度为30个字符,简介长度为120个字符,按照热度排序。

在DedeCMS中,要在模板页实现arclist分页效果,需要结合使用JavaScript和dede:arclist标签,具体操作可以分为以下几个步骤:

1、引入JavaScript:在文章模板页的HTML文件头部,即head区域内,引入必要的JavaScript代码,这段代码将负责处理分页的逻辑,包括获取当前页面数、总页数以及根据用户的操作(如点击“下一页”)来动态更新文章列表的内容。

2、添加dede:arclist标签:在模板文件中指定显示列表的位置,添加dede:arclist标签,这个标签用于生成文章列表,其属性包括每行显示的文章数(row)、标题长度限制(titlelen)等。

3、设置arclist标签属性:在arclist标签中,通过设置pagesize属性来控制每页显示的文章数量,通过tagid属性为列表分配一个唯一的标识,以便JavaScript能够识别并进行相应的分页处理。

4、配置分页样式:为了让分页效果更加美观和用户友好,可以通过CSS来配置分页链接的样式,例如颜色、大小、鼠标悬停效果等。

5、实现分页功能:利用JavaScript函数来实现分页功能,当用户点击分页链接时,会触发JavaScript函数,该函数通过Ajax请求从服务器获取对应页码的文章数据,并更新到页面上,实现无缝的分页浏览体验。

便是在DedeCMS中实现arclist分页效果的基本步骤,为了确保顺利实现分页效果,还需要注意以下几点:

确保使用的JavaScript代码与DedeCMS的版本兼容。

在修改模板文件之前,最好先进行备份,以防万一修改错误导致问题。

对于不同的网站风格和布局,可能需要调整CSS样式以适应整体设计。

考虑到用户体验,分页逻辑中的加载动画和错误处理也很重要。

不要忘记测试分页功能在不同浏览器中的表现,确保兼容性和稳定性。

通过合理地结合使用JavaScript和dede:arclist标签,可以在DedeCMS模板页中实现arclist分页效果,提升用户的阅读体验,实际操作中,还需要根据网站的具体情况进行调整和优化,以达到最佳的展示效果。

相关问答FAQs

Q1: 如何自定义分页链接的样式?

Q2: 如果分页功能无法正常工作,应该如何排查问题?

Q1: 如何自定义分页链接的样式?

Q2: 如果分页功能无法正常工作,应该如何排查问题?

0